Select...
Search for anything...

Payal Hotel Banner

Business Information

Payal Hotel is situated at Opposite Bus Stand, Near City Railway Station, Udiapole, Udaipur 313001
You can contact Payal Hotel on Show Number
Payal Hotel is most searched in Hotels,Hotels Budget

Also listed in

  • Hotels
  • Hotels Budget

Reviews & Rating

5
0%
4
0%
3
0%
2
0%
1
0%
0
reviews
Write a Review

Related Listings

More Listings in this area